About the Instructor
Holly Lyn Walrath is a narrative artist focusing on the merging of art and words. From erasure poetry to radical zines to speculative fiction to poem paintings, Holly's work explores all things cross-genre. Holly has taught writing and art workshops online and in the Houston area for over ten years.
Her writing has appeared in Strange Horizons, Fireside Fiction, Analog, and Flash Fiction Online. She is the author of three books, including Glimmerglass Girl, The Smallest of Bones, and Numinous Stones. She holds a B.A. in English from the University of Texas and a Master’s in Creative Writing from the University of Denver. She is the managing editor of Interstellar Flight Press, an indie SFFH publisher dedicated to publishing underrepresented voices and genres. As a freelance editor, she provides editing services for writers and organizations of all genres, experiences, and backgrounds, but enjoys working with new writers best.
About Merge Studio
Merge is the thought-child of artists Holly Lyn Walrath and Leslie Archibald. It's a space to explore the merging of minds and the merging of arts of all kinds. Merge hosts monthly workshops and creative experiences out of 2000 Nance Street, Studio B-126
